GST Refund Planning for Manufacturing Businesses

0
55

Manufacturing businesses often accumulate significant input tax credit because GST paid on raw materials, components, services and other business inputs may not always be fully adjusted against output tax liability.

This situation can be more common in export-oriented businesses and industries where the tax rate on inputs differs from the applicable rate on finished products. Therefore, manufacturers should review GST credit accumulation regularly instead of waiting until the amount becomes substantial.

Why Does GST Credit Accumulate?

Input tax credit may build up for several reasons, including:

  • Export of goods under LUT
  • Inverted duty structure
  • Higher GST rates on eligible inputs
  • Seasonal fluctuations in sales
  • Expansion in production
  • Increase in procurement
  • Changes in product mix

Businesses should first identify why the credit is accumulating before deciding whether a refund application may be appropriate.

Review Refund Eligibility Before Filing

A GST balance appearing in the electronic credit ledger does not automatically mean that the entire amount is refundable.

Manufacturers considering GST refund planning for accumulated ITC should review the nature of supplies, relevant tax period, eligible input credit, turnover details and supporting records before preparing the refund application.

Businesses should also reconcile GST returns with purchase records and financial books because inconsistencies may lead to additional queries during processing.

Industry-Specific Review Can Be Important

The reason for accumulated credit can vary considerably between industries.

For example, pharmaceutical manufacturers may purchase APIs, chemicals, packaging materials and other inputs under different GST classifications while supplying finished pharmaceutical products under another tax structure.

Because of this, GST refund assessment for pharmaceutical manufacturers should consider product classification, eligible inputs, applicable output GST rates and the refund methodology relevant to the particular transaction.

Similar reviews may also be required for engineering, automobile, textile, electronics and other manufacturing sectors.

Documentation Should Be Prepared Early

Before submitting a refund application, manufacturers should maintain organised supporting records such as:

  • GST returns for the relevant period
  • Purchase register
  • Sales register
  • Tax invoices
  • Electronic credit ledger
  • HSN-wise transaction details
  • Export documents, where applicable
  • Turnover reconciliation
  • Working of eligible refund amount

Preparing these records early can make it easier to identify differences before filing.

Reconcile GST Data With Accounting Records

Refund applications should not be prepared only from one GST return.

The figures should generally be compared with accounting records and other available GST data. Differences in purchase value, taxable turnover, invoice details or ITC reporting should be reviewed before the refund calculation is finalised.

This is particularly relevant for manufacturers processing a large number of monthly transactions.

Monitor Refund Applications After Filing

The refund process does not necessarily end when the application is submitted.

Businesses should monitor acknowledgements, deficiency communications and other notices appearing on the GST portal. If clarification or additional documents are requested, the response should be prepared using the same reconciled records used for the original application.

Conclusion

GST refund planning is primarily a documentation and reconciliation exercise. Manufacturers should first understand why ITC is accumulating, determine whether the relevant credit may qualify for refund and maintain supporting records for the applicable tax period.

A structured review can help businesses identify reporting differences early and maintain clearer documentation for future GST refund applications.
